I think it’s easy to get upgrades - as some airlines do allow local staff to issue UGs plane-side at their discretion, or perhaps it’s not an officially endorsed policy, but carriers don’t enforce non-compliance.

 

What I would wonder is IF he actually got to fly for “free” as flight deck personnel commonly do so under the OMC or Observer Member Crew, protocol and do use this, one of the common requirements is not only your current ID, but passport AND your current Class 1 medical card... and few people outside of flight deck crew have one.. so maybe we went as a CJA (Cabin Jumpseat Authority) but was given a cabin seat instead.
